S E C O R <br /> i <br /> • 1.0 SITE DESCRIPTION <br /> This first quarter 2008 Site Status remedial summary and groundwater monitoring report <br /> describes activities conducted on behalf of CEMC and COP for the site located adjacent to and <br /> along the eastern boundary of the Delta View Apartments (802 West Weber Avenue) and west <br /> of the North Lincoln Street and West Weber Avenue cross road in San Joaquin County, <br /> California (Figure 1). The Site is currently owned by the City of Stockton Redevelopment <br /> Agency (RDA), which refers to the Site as "Parcel 2A". The Site currently consists of relatively <br /> flat, fallow land and is mostly undeveloped except for the Delta View Apartments (formerly the <br /> Delta Gateway Apartments) located on the western portion of the Site. The Stockton Deep <br /> Water Channel, Weber Avenue and an office building complex are located north of the Site. <br /> The Mormon Slough, a children's museum, and Work Net building are located to the south and <br /> east of the Site, respectively. <br /> During a December 2, 2002 meeting with the California Regional Water Quality Control Board <br /> Central Valley Region (CRWQCB-CVR), environmental management of the Site was divided <br /> into three OUs: L&M OU; Unocal OU (UOU); and Morton OU (MOU). The L&M OU was <br /> established to direct investigations in the area south of West Weber Avenue, west of the midline <br /> of the former Harrison Street, east of North Edison, and north of former Main Street (Appendix <br /> A). This OU includes monitoring wells MW-4, MW-9, MW-10, 2AMW-12 through 2AMW-14, <br /> MW-16 through MW-35, MW-40 through MW-55, and dual phase extraction (DPE) wells DPE-1 <br /> through DPE-13. The UOU was established to direct investigations from West Weber Street <br /> south to the former Main Street and from the midline of the former Harrison Street east to <br /> • Lincoln Street. This OU includes monitoring wells MW-3, MW-5, MW-7, MW-8, MW-11, and <br /> MW-37 through MW-39. The MOU was established to direct investigations from the middle of <br /> the former Main Street down to the southern boundary of Parcel 2A and from the midline of the <br /> former Harrison Street east to Lincoln Street. The MOU includes monitoring wells MW-6, <br /> 2BMW-1, and 2AMW-15. Currently, oversight of environmental management responsibilities of <br /> the L&M OU is retained by SECOR on behalf of CEMC and COP, and oversight of the UOU and <br /> MOU is performed by Wallace Kuhl Associates (Wallace-Kuhl), on behalf of the RDA's <br /> subcontractor(Golden State Environmental). <br /> • <br /> 1QO8QSSRQRSRQMR.F1na1.doc 1 April 30,2008 <br /> 77Tw.26397.42.1307 <br />
